There's no single official "RA diet," but there are well-supported eating patterns that can help reduce inflammation and manage symptoms.

The Mediterranean diet is the most recommended for RA. It focuses on:

- Fresh fruits and vegetables
- Whole grains
- Fatty fish (like salmon, sardines, and trout)
- Legumes and nuts
- Extra-virgin olive oil

It's also generally advised to limit or avoid:

- Red meat
- Processed foods
- Refined sugars and sugary drinks
- Trans fats (like margarine and deep-fried foods) Some myRAteam members have also found success with gluten-free or ketogenic diets, though results vary widely from person to person. As one myRAteam member shared, cutting out sugar and processed foods led to noticeable reductions in swelling within just a few days.

Since everyone's triggers are different, keeping a food diary can help identify what works — and what doesn't — for you specifically. Working with a dietitian is a great way to build a plan that fits your needs and doesn't leave any nutritional gaps.
